
The Four Just Men
The Four Just Men
Release: 1939-06-01·Runtime: 85m·★ 6.7
ThrillerMysteryDrama
The Four Men of the title are British WWI veterans who decide to work secretly against enemies of the country. They aren't above a bit of murder or sabotage to serve their ends, but they consider themselves to be true patriots.
